Transaction 9b93c77dbcbf5bd2ef19ed16795122b068db78196e3f99b031d5bd67fcffb420
1 Input
1 Output
-
9b93c77dbcbf5bd2ef19ed16795122b068db78196e3f99b031d5bd67fcffb420:0
- value
- 570548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bba6a1d4aeac2c5818bd28a6429cdec638303792 OP_EQUAL
- address
- 3JoDuDmNSKe3fng3puQhwsFFEE1fM7E95m